The top of a ladder 17m long when placed against a wall reaches a height
of 15m. How far is the foot of the ladder from the wall?

Answer:

8

Step-by-step explanation:

use Pythagoras property because it is a right angle triangle

(h^2) + (b^2) = (hypo^2)

(15*15) + (b^2) = 17*17

225 + (b^2) = 289

b = 289-225 = 64

8*8 = 64

therefore, b^2 = 8
